Excel2000をXPで使っています。
Enterキーを押すことによって、横(右)のセルに移動してしまいます。
Enterキーでは下のセルに移動させたいのですが、何か設定が悪いのでしょうか?
ご存知の方がいらっしゃいましたら教えてください。

このQ&Aに関連する最新のQ&A

A 回答 (2件)

"Excel2000"の『ツール』→『オプション』→『編集』タブの『入力後にセルを移動する』の下の『方向』の所で移動方向を『下』に変更すればよいかと思いますが・・・。

    • good
    • 0
この回答へのお礼

ありがとうございました。
ばっちりできました。
その辺に設定があるんじゃないかと思って、探したはずなんですが・・・
目が節穴でした。

お礼日時:2002/01/11 01:28

厳しいことを書きますが、過去の質問を一度検索することをお勧めします。


1週間もしないうちに同じ質問が出るとは・・・・

参考URLをご覧下さい。

参考URL:http://www.okweb.ne.jp/kotaeru.php3?q=192338
    • good
    • 0
この回答へのお礼

大変失礼しました。検索をサボりました。
でも、おかげであなたもポイントをもらうことができたし、
そう堅いことを言わずに!ハッピー!ハッピー!

お礼日時:2002/01/11 01:35

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!

このQ&Aと関連する良く見られている質問

QExcel VBA あるセルでENTERを押すと特定のセルへ移動したい

Excel VBAで例えばセル"A2"をセレクトしている状態で
「ENTER」を押すとB5に自動的にセレクトすることはできないでしょうか?

Worksheet_Change関数を使おうと思ったのですが
"A2"の中身が変化しないと発動しません。

Worksheet_SelectionChange関数を使って"A2"を選択している状態で「ENTER」を押すと"A3"が選択されることを利用し、
「"A3"が選択されたら"B5"に飛ぶ」
も考えたのですが、マウスやキーボード操作で"A3"を
選択すると"B5"に飛んでしまうので、これも使えません。

何か対策案はないでしょうか。ご教授よろしくお願いします。

Aベストアンサー

こんばんは。

これは、定番のコードですが、私は、それに、もう少し工夫を凝らしてみました。
本来は、クラスによるインスタンスが良いとは思いますが、それを一般的にお勧めするには、ちょっと荷が重いような気がしました。

'<標準モジュール>

Private Sub ReturnDirectrion2SelectCell()
 If ActiveCell.Address(0, 0) Like "A2" Then
  Range("B5").Select
 Else
  'Original ReturnDirection の再現
  On Error Resume Next
  Select Case Application.MoveAfterReturnDirection
  Case xlDown
    ActiveCell.Offset(1).Select
  Case xlToRight
    ActiveCell.Offset(, 1).Select
  Case xlToLeft
    ActiveCell.Offset(, -1).Select
  Case xlUp
    ActiveCell.Offset(-1).Select
  End Select
 End If
End Sub

Sub SetKeys()
  '設定用
  Application.OnKey "~", "ReturnDirectrion2SelectCell"
  Application.OnKey "{Enter}", "ReturnDirectrion2SelectCell"
End Sub
Sub SetOffKeys()
 '解除用
 Application.OnKey "~"
 Application.OnKey "{Enter}"
End Sub

'-----------------------------------------

自動設定が必要な場合は、以下のコードを加えてください。

'-----------------------------------------
'<標準モジュール>
Sub Auto_Open()
 Call SetKeys
End If
Sub Auto_Close()
 Call SetOffKeys
End If
'-----------------------------------------

なお、現在の設定では、全てのブックの全てのシートに同じように適用されます。Auto_Open等の代わりに、例えば、Worksheet_Activate や Workbook_SheetActivateなどに、SetKeysをCall し、Worksheet_DeactivateやWorkbook_SheetDeactivateに、SetOffKeysをCallするようにすると良いと思います。

こんばんは。

これは、定番のコードですが、私は、それに、もう少し工夫を凝らしてみました。
本来は、クラスによるインスタンスが良いとは思いますが、それを一般的にお勧めするには、ちょっと荷が重いような気がしました。

'<標準モジュール>

Private Sub ReturnDirectrion2SelectCell()
 If ActiveCell.Address(0, 0) Like "A2" Then
  Range("B5").Select
 Else
  'Original ReturnDirection の再現
  On Error Resume Next
  Select Case Application.MoveAfterReturnDirection
  ...続きを読む

Qエクセル:セル上でEnterを押した時のカーソルの移動方向

通常、セルの上でEnterキーを押した場合、
カーソルは1つ下のセルへ移動しますよね。
これを、「Enterキーを押した時に1つ右のセルへ移動させる」という設定にしたいのですが、
どこで設定するかわかる方いましたら教えていただきたいです。

たしかそのような設定ウィンドウを見かけたことがあったと思うのですが、
ちょっと自信なくなってきた…。

Aベストアンサー

ツールからオプションをクリック、編集タグの中に入力後にセルの移動の方向を下になっているのを右に直してOKすれば右に移動するようになります。

QエクセルのEnterキーでのセルの移動

エクセルのEnterキーでセルを下に移動する時、同じファイルで同じように入力しているのに、Enterキー1回で下の行に移動する場合と、2回で移動する場合があるのです。いろいろやってみたのですが、どうしてなのかわからなくて悩んでいます。どなたかご存知の方いらしたら教えてください。

Aベストアンサー

多分、日本語入力している場合(IMEを利用している場合)と、
英数字を直接入力している場合との違いではないでしょうか?

日本語入力している場合、一回目のENTER日本語文字の確定となり、
2回目のENTERがEXCEL本来のものです。
一方、英数字を直接入力している場合、
日本語文字の確定は不要ですから、
一回のENTERですみます。

QExcelで、Enterキーでセルの移動ができない

Enterキーで下のセルに移動をすることができなくなり、
逆に、Altを押さなくてもセル内で改行がされるようになりました。

また、セルを選択しただけでは入力できず、
入力するためにはダブルクリックしなければならなくなりました。


これはこれで便利な時もありそうですが、やっぱり今はEnterでセル移動がしたいです…


特に設定を変えたつもりはないのですが、
元に戻す方法を教えてください。


Microsoft Excel 2003 を使っています。

宜しくお願いします。

Aベストアンサー

ツール→オプション→編集で、「入力後にセルを移動する」のチェックが外れていませんか?

QエクセルのEnterを押した後のセルの移動の設定で

エクセルのEnterを押した後のセルの移動の設定で
「Enterキーを押した後にセルを移動する」というオプションをよく使うのですが、
毎回、エクセルのオプション→詳細設定→Enterキーを押した・・という手順で
Enterキーを押した後にセルを移動する方向を指定するのが面倒なので、どこかに
ショートカットボタンを作ったり、ショートカットキーなどで一発で呼び出せない
でしょうか?

使用しているOSはWindows7で
エクセル2010です

Aベストアンサー

切り替え操作をマクロ記録でショートカット設定しては如何でしょうか。
マクロ記録→ショートカットキーの設定→Officeボタン押下→Excelのオプション→詳細設定→カーソル位置を設定→OK→記録の終了


このカテゴリの人気Q&Aランキング

おすすめ情報